Subject: DR drill — Quillhaven checkout load test

Hi — scheduling the disaster-recovery drill for next Thursday. We'll load-test the Quillhaven checkout flow at 3x normal traffic, then deliberately fail over the payments tier to the Marrowfield standby cluster. Your part: once failover completes, restore the synthetic-buyer account so the test harness can resume. The restore prompt in the drill console will ask for the recovery passphrase, which appears directly below.

vault phrase of hahip-kafog = druix-quenmir-jorox

## Deploying the Gatewick Proctor Queue

Deploys are pretty painless: push to main, wait for the pipeline, then watch the queue drain dashboard for five minutes. If candidates pile up mid-exam, roll back first and ask questions later — the queue replays safely. Everything the workers care about lives in one config block, shown here for reference.

settings of bafof-yagef:
JOROX_PIN=8740
JOROX_TENANT=pelox
JOROX_METRICS_HOST=metrics.jorox.qorvelworks.internal
JOROX_SEAL=seal_c78f63c1
JOROX_STANDBY_TEAM=norax

Handover note — Crumbwheel order cutoffs.

Welcome aboard. The bakery cutoff rule in Crumbwheel closes same-day orders at 14:00 local to each storefront, not UTC — this has bitten us twice. Holiday overrides live in the calendar service and take precedence silently, so always check there first when a cutoff looks wrong. To unlock the calendar service's admin console after a restart, enter the recovery passphrase below.

vault phrase of bagap-bahaf = silion-pelox-sorox-casdor-quenwyn-fraax-eliox-praael-kelion-quenvan-kasox-rusael-norius-belvan